The collection consists of one watercolor of Josephine Baker, approximately 3 1/2 inches by 5 inches. Date is unknown (possibly 1929) and the artist's signature illegible.

1 item (0.1 linear feet).

Josephine Baker(1906-1975) was a dancer, singer, and civil rights activist. She performed in Paris, New York, Africa, and the Middle East, and was a crusader for racial equality. She was born Freda Josephine McDonald in St. Louis, Missouri, the daughter of Eddie Carson, a musician, and Carrie Macdonald.
